ASHINGTON (AP) President Joe Biden signed into law Wednesday an act to dismantle part of the Trump era, blocking payday lenders om avoiding caps on interest rates, "This rule reflects a return to common sense and a commitment to the common good," liden said before the signing, surrounded by congressional leaders who joined him as he turned the resolution into law. Under ormer President Donald Trump, the Office of the Comptroller of the Currency had enabled payday lenders to charge interest rates in excess of what was allowed by the different states. Under the Trump Administration rule, payday lenders were able to partner with a nationally chartered bank to make high-cost loans and avoid state usury laws. States across the country have established limits on fees that could be charged for payday loans in order to protect vulnerable consumers under financial stress from exorbitant lending costs. NOTE: A payday loan is a short-term, high cost loan, generally for $500 or less, that is typically due on your next payday. Many states considered payday loans a legal form of loan sharking, so caps were put in place by state legislatures to limit the fees and interest rates a lender could charge for a payday loan. Stations cannot air obscene or indecent material. However, they may air potentially offensive content between 10 PM and 6 AM.
Obscene material is prohibited from being aired on radio or television stations, according to the Federal Communications Commission (FCC) guidelines.
Indecent material, while not completely banned, is restricted to air during late-night hours, specifically between 10 PM and 6 AM.
This timeframe is designed to minimize exposure to children, as they are less likely to be watching or listening during these hours.
It is essential for broadcasters to adhere to these guidelines, as violating them can result in fines, license revocation, or other penalties imposed by the FCC.

Segregation is a policy of keeping racial-ethnic groups apart.
Segregation refers to the practice of separating racial-ethnic groups based on various factors such as race, ethnicity, or national origin. It involves the establishment of physical, social, or legal barriers that limit or restrict interactions between different racial-ethnic groups. Segregation can manifest in various forms, including residential segregation, educational segregation, and segregation in public facilities such as transportation, parks, or restaurants.
Historically, segregation has been used as a means of maintaining social, economic, and political control by promoting inequality and discrimination. It has perpetuated racial disparities, limited opportunities for marginalized groups, and undermined the principles of equality and inclusivity.
While significant progress has been made in addressing segregation through civil rights movements and legal reforms, its effects still linger in some societies. Efforts to combat segregation involve promoting integration, diversity, and equal access to resources and opportunities for all individuals, regardless of their racial or ethnic background.

Hieronymus Bosch's famous triptych, the Garden of Earthly Delights, seems to have been intended to explore the themes of sin, temptation, and the consequences of indulging in earthly pleasures.
The painting's central panel depicts a surreal landscape filled with fantastical creatures and hedonistic scenes, while the left and right panels offer contrasting visions of the punishment that awaits those who give in to temptation.
Bosch's work reflects the medieval Christian worldview, which saw the world as a fallen place and emphasized the importance of resisting temptation and living a virtuous life. Through his vivid and unsettling imagery, Bosch challenges viewers to consider the consequences of their actions and the fragility of human morality.
